Benefits:

Medium voltage (MV) cables with Ethylene Propylene Rubber (EPR) or Cross-Linked Polyethylene (XLP) insulation are essential for power distribution, industrial applications, and infrastructure. They offer strong dielectric strength, ensuring efficient power transmission with minimal energy loss. EPR and XLP improve durability, chemical resistance, and reliability, reducing maintenance and extending service life. These cables are ideal for substations, manufacturing plants, transportation systems, and large commercial facilities, providing a safe, efficient, and cost-effective power solution.

  • High-quality insulation materials
  • Transmits power efficiently over long distances with minimal energy loss
  • Thicker insulation and shielding for enhanced safety and reliability
  • Moisture-resistant, weatherproof, fire-resistant, UV-resistant, and chemical-resistant insulation options available
  • Suitable for underground installations


When to use:

Substations to Distribution Points: MV cables are used to connect substations to local distribution transformers or points of use. These cables are responsible for carrying power from high-voltage transmission lines and distributing it to homes, businesses, and industrial facilities.

Underground Distribution: In urban areas, medium voltage cables are commonly used for underground distribution networks, as they are safer and more reliable than overhead lines.

Industrial Facilities: Powering large machinery and equipment, such as motors and heavy machinery, in factories and plants.

Renewable Energy: Connecting wind turbines and solar panels to the grid or between different parts of renewable energy installations.

Large Commercial Buildings: Distributing power within large commercial buildings, campuses, or complexes for systems like HVAC or centralized electrical systems.

Electric Vehicle (EV) Charging Stations: As EV charging infrastructure grows, MV cables are used to distribute power to high-capacity charging stations.

EPR vs. XLPE


EPR (Ethylene Propylene Rubber) and XLPE (Cross-linked Polyethylene) are both thermoset insulations, but they differ significantly in flexibility, performance, and typical applications.


  • Use EPR:
    • High flexibility for tight bends
    • Resists moisture—great for wet locations
    • Handles mechanical stress well
    • Stable across wide temperature ranges

  • Use XLPE (also known as XLP):
    • Higher temperature performance
    • Lower dielectric losses improve efficiency
    • Lighter weight for easier handling
    • Cost-effective in dry, controlled settings
